Once pasteurized, this Hiyaoroshi expresses the characteristically higher acidity and apple aromas of many of the sake of the Zaruso Hourai brand, maintaining a great combination of sweet, sour and bitter. When enjoyed chilled, the experience of this sake is juicy and refreshing. However, when enjoyed warmed, the acidity is enhanced and the sweetness becomes bolder.

Oya Takashi Shuzo大矢孝酒造

Now operating under its 8th generation of Kuramoto, the brewery has 2 well established brands, "Zaruso Hourai" and "Shoryu Hourai". The Zaruso Hourai brand represents sake made in the Sokujo brewing method in which lactic acid is added to the yeast starter, a more modern and consistently used method of brewing. This brand includes the Queeen, a full flavoured genshu, yet slightly lower alcohol, that has become a favorite amongst younger sake fans who want something that does not make them so easily intoxicated.
